Hope Valley 1874 Episode 7 had everything it needed to be the best episode of the season — a hostage situation, a tense Mountie standoff in the woods, and a slow-burn romance finally showing its hand. So why did we finish it feeling kind of empty? Eric and Andrea break down what worked, what completely fizzled, and whether they'll be back for Season 2.

WHAT YOU'LL HEAR

•       The Mountie standoff in the woods: three crooked ranchers, a big build-up, and a resolution so anticlimactic we had to laugh

•       Alexander's fishing confession — he already knew how to fish, and somehow that's the most romantic thing he's done all season

•       The British prospector who showed up with one episode to go and why we're skeptical the show can land that storyline in time

•       That 8.9 IMDb rating — and the honest question of whether people are watching the same show we are

•       Andrea's verdict on Season 2 (hint: her reading list might win)
